Form: Circular. Roughened surfaces.
By: South African Mint
Date: 1967
Ref:  Laidlaw: 0812;
Variations:
SizeMetalMassValue
38.0 mmSilver27.5 gm$35

Edge: Plain. Stamped with SA Mint marks: "(lion head) STG S(for 1966) S.A.M".

Obverse: Coat of arm of the Z.A. Republic with motto: “EENDRAGT MAAKT MAGT”. Legend above: “NEDERDUITSCH HERVORMDE KERK” and below: “AFRIKA”

Reverse: Facade of the Old Arts Building at the University of Pretoria. Across, above: “50 / JAAR” and below: “1-4-1917 (left) 1-4-1967 (right)”. Legend above: “TEOLOGIES” and below: “OPLEIDING”.

Notes: Comes in a blue case lined with white silk-like and blue velvet-like material. Marked: "SAM" on the inside of the lid.

The Faculty of Theology was established at the Transvaal University College (later the University of Pretoria) in 1917. Two lecturers were appointed, one from the Nederduitsch Hervormde Kerk and the other from the Presbyterian Church.
